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they’re a sign of a more serious issue.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your warehouse can be a sign of mold growth. Mold can cause serious health risks and damage to your equipment and materials. If you notice a musty smell,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ue immediately.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ains on ceilings and wal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Ignoring these stains can lead to further damage and costly repairs. If you notice water stains,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Ignoring this issue can lead to further damage and costly repairs. If you notice warped or buckled flooring,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ue immediately.

Visible Signs of Leaks

Visible signs of leaks, such as water droplets or puddles, can be a sign of a serious issue. Ignoring these signs can lead to further damage and costly repairs. If you notice visible signs of leaks,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your warehouse can be a sign of a serious issue. Mold and mildew can thrive in humid environments, causing serious health risks and damage to your equipment and materials. If you notice increased humidity or moisture,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ue immediately.
